Jolyon refreshed and ‘raring to go’ for Spa GP2 weekend

Jolyon Palmer says he's feeling refreshed and 'raring to go' after the summer break and aims to be challenging for podiums during this weekend's (31 August - 2 September) GP2 rounds at Spa.

The 21-year-old from Southwater has enjoyed a four week break since the last rounds at the Hungaroring where he secured two impressive top six finishes to move up to 10th in the drivers' standings. He's now hoping to continue his strong form into rounds 19 and 20 at the legendary Belgian track, which signals the closing stages of the 2012 season with just two events left to play out.

"I'm looking forward to getting back in the car again at Spa after the August break," said Jolyon. "It's been nice to have a bit of time off but now I'm raring to go again in the last three rounds of the season. Spa is a great track which is really enjoyable to drive. The racing should be entertaining with good overtaking opportunities and the weather will surely play a part there as always."

He added: "I'm confident of our pace and I'm hoping to be on the podium there. I have won there before in FPA and to repeat that in GP2 would be incredible."
 
Rounds 19 and 20 of the 2012 GP2 Series get underway at Spa-Francorchamps from 31 August - 2 September with full coverage on Jolyon's website www.jolyonpalmer.com. All four GP2 sessions will also be screened live in the UK on the new Sky Sports F1 channel.
